The Complete Guide to Exercise Bikes: A Comprehensive Overview

Exercise bikes have actually become an iconic tool in both home and business fitness centers, offering a convenient and efficient way to take part in cardiovascular exercise. They deal with fitness lovers of all levels, from newbies to skilled professional athletes. This article dives deep into the world of exercise bikes, discussing their types, benefits, functions, and more.

Types of Exercise Bikes

Exercise bikes can be found in different designs, each created to accommodate different fitness needs and preferences. Here are the primary types:

Type of mini exercise Cycle BikeDescriptionBest For
Upright BikesFeature a standard biking position and adjustable seatsGeneral fitness and endurance training
Recumbent BikesHave a reclined seat position that supplies back supportThose with back concerns or recovering from injury
Spin BikesTough bikes for high-intensity interval training (HIIT) and spin classesSpin lovers and extreme exercises
Air BikesUtilize a fan to offer resistance and intensity based upon user effortAdvanced trainers and strength structure exercises

Benefits of Using an Exercise Bike

1. Cardiovascular Fitness

Exercise bikes provide an exceptional cardiovascular exercise. They help reinforce the heart and lungs, boost endurance, and improve general fitness.

2. Low Impact

Biking is a low-impact exercise, lessening stress on the joints. This makes stationary bicycle ideal for people with joint concerns or those rehabilitating from injuries.

3. Weight Management

Routine usage of exercise bikes promotes calorie burning, which can assist in weight-loss or maintenance when combined with a well balanced diet plan.

4. Convenience

Exercise bikes can be used in the house, getting rid of travel time to the gym. This convenience results in more constant exercises.

5. Adjustable Resistance

Many stationary bicycle come with adjustable resistance levels, permitting users to tailor their workouts to their personal fitness levels and goals.

Secret Features to Consider When Buying an Exercise Bike

When buying a stationary bicycle, it's vital to consider several functions to ensure the finest suitable for your needs:

1. Comfort

  • Seat Cushioning: Look for a cushioned seat for added comfort during long workouts.
  • Adjustable Seat Height: An adjustable seat ensures proper positioning and avoids discomfort.

2. Resistance Levels

  • Types of Resistance: Bikes might include magnetic, friction, or air resistance. Select one based upon your preference for smoothness and sound level.
  • Variety of Levels: More levels provide greater flexibility in your exercise.

3. Show Console

  • Functions like heart rate monitoring, range tracking, and workout programs can improve motivation and provide important exercise data.

4. Size and Portability

  • Consider the dimensions and weight of the bike, specifically if area is limited. Look for options with transportation wheels for easy movement.

5. Extra Features

  • Bluetooth Connectivity: Some bikes provide connection to apps that track fitness metrics or offer assisted exercises.
  • Integrated Speakers: For those who enjoy music, built-in speakers can boost the exercise experience.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. How often should I use an exercise bike?

For ideal outcomes, goal for a minimum of 150 minutes of moderate aerobic exercise or 75 minutes of energetic exercise per week, which can be broken down into workable sessions.

2. Can I drop weight utilizing a stationary bicycle?

Yes, cycling can assist burn calories and assistance weight reduction when accompanied by a well balanced diet plan. The rate of weight reduction depends upon intensity, duration, and frequency of workouts.

3. Is it safe for elders to use exercise bikes?

Absolutely! Stationary bicycle provide a low-impact alternative that is gentle on the joints, making them ideal for senior citizens. However, assessment with a doctor for tailored recommendations is a good idea.

4. Do I require to wear special shoes for biking?

While you can use regular athletic shoes, some bikes come with SPD-compatible pedals, which are designed for biking shoes that clip into the pedals for boosted stability and performance.
